There are two artists using this name: 1) Dysrhythmia is an American instrumental progressive metal band formed in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ania in 1998. The band's music combines avant-garde elements of progressive rock and jazz with heavy metal. They are currently located in Brooklyn, New York. Their most recent release, Psychic Maps, was released in July 2009 via Relapse Records. The band was formed in August 1998 by guitarist Kevin Hurnagel and bassist Clayton Ingerson, who were joined six months later by drummer Jeff Eber.
